How to Make Cranberry Feta Pinwheels with Cream Cheese Recipe
Step 1: Prepare the Cream Cheese Mixture
Start by softening your cream cheese to make it easier to spread. In a bowl, blend the cream cheese with a touch of honey (if you like a hint of sweetness), freshly ground black pepper, and the chopped fresh parsley. This mixture will add creamy richness with an herby freshness that sets the foundation for the pinwheels.
Step 2: Layer the Tortillas
Lay your flour tortillas flat on a clean surface. Use a generous but even layer of the cream cheese mixture, spreading all the way to the edges so every bite is flavorful. This will help bind the cranberries and feta to the tortilla and keep every roll tightly packed.
Step 3: Add the Cranberries and Feta
Sprinkle the dried cranberries evenly over the cream cheese layer, followed by crumbled feta cheese. The combination of salty feta and sweet cranberries is irresistible, offering bursts of contrasting flavors that make these pinwheels so special and memorable.
Step 4: Roll and Chill
Carefully roll each tortilla into a tight cylinder, trying to keep the filling inside without squeezing too hard. Wrap each roll in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es. This chilling step firms up the cream cheese mixture, making it easier to slice and helping the pinwheels hold their shape beautifully.
Step 5: Slice and Serve
Once chilled, unwrap the rolls and slice them into 1-inch pinwheels using a sharp knife. Try to make clean, smooth cuts that keep your pinwheels intact for an elegant presentation. Arrange them on a serving platter and get ready to impress!

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
You can store leftover Cranberry Feta Pinwheels with Cream Cheese Recipe in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Make sure they are well covered to prevent the tortillas from drying out and keep that fresh texture intact.
Freezing
While these pinwheels are best enjoyed fresh for optimal texture, you can freeze them if needed. Place the pinwheels on a parchment-lined tray to freeze individually before transferring them to a freezer bag. They will keep for up to one month. However, thaw gently in the fridge to avoid sogginess.
Reheating
Since these are cold appetizers, reheating is not necessary—and actually not recommended, as heat can change the creamy texture and make the cream cheese melt and lose its charm. Serve them chilled or at room temperature for the best experience.
FAQs
Can I use fresh cranberries instead of dried?
Fresh cranberries are quite tart and have a firmer texture compared to dried ones, so they may not blend as smoothly into the pinwheels. If you do use fresh, consider lightly cooking or sweetening them beforehand to soften their bite.
Is there a way to make this recipe vegan?
Absolutely! Swap out the cream cheese and feta for their plant-based alternatives. Many cashew-based cream cheeses and vegan feta options work wonderfully and maintain the creamy, tangy profile without any dairy.
How far ahead can I prepare these pinwheels?
You can prepare the pinwheels a day ahead and keep them refrigerated until serving. This actually helps the flavors meld beautifully and makes slicing easier when chilled.
Can I use different tortillas, like whole wheat or gluten-free?
Yes! Whole wheat or gluten-free tortillas can be used depending on your preference or dietary needs. Just make sure they are pliable enough to roll without cracking for the best results.
